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

الطابع الزمني </ h2>

في سياق قواعد البيانات ، يمثل الطابع الزمني نقطة زمنية فريدة ومتسلسلة ، عادةً بدقة تصل إلى ملي ثانية ، والتي يمكن استخدامها لأغراض مختلفة بما في ذلك تعقب البيانات والمزامنة والتحكم في التزامن. تلعب الطوابع الزمنية دورًا مهمًا في أنظمة قواعد البيانات الحديثة ، مما يضمن تكامل البيانات والاتساق والتعامل الفعال للعمليات - الخصائص الأساسية المتوقعة في مجال إدارة قواعد البيانات.

تُستخدم الطوابع الزمنية على نطاق واسع في أنظمة قواعد البيانات الموزعة والتطبيقات متعددة المستخدمين ، مما يجعل من الممكن إدارة البيانات ومزامنتها عبر أنظمة ومستخدمين متعددين في وقت واحد. تتضمن التطبيقات الواقعية للطوابع الزمنية معالجة المعاملات عبر الإنترنت وتخزين البيانات وتحليل السلاسل الزمنية ، من بين أمور أخرى.

في نطاق أنظمة قواعد البيانات ، يتم تنفيذ الطوابع الزمنية بشكل شائع في نوعين رئيسيين: الطوابع الزمنية للنظام والطوابع الزمنية المنطقية .

  • الطوابع الزمنية للنظام : يتم إنشاؤها بناءً على الوقت المطلق الذي تم الحصول عليه من ساعة الخادم أو الجهاز. تعد الطوابع الزمنية للنظام مفيدة للتطبيقات التي تتطلب توقيتًا دقيقًا للحدث أو التسجيل أو المزامنة مع العمليات الخارجية. ومع ذلك ، فهي عرضة لمشاكل مزامنة الساعة المحتملة مثل انحراف الساعة وزمن انتقال الشبكة. يعد حل هذه المشكلات أمرًا بالغ الأهمية للحفاظ على اتساق البيانات عبر الأنظمة الموزعة.
  • الطوابع الزمنية المنطقية : على عكس الطوابع الزمنية للنظام ، لا تعتمد الطوابع الزمنية المنطقية على الوقت الفعلي ولكن يتم إنشاؤها من خلال عداد تسلسلي يتزايد في كل مرة تحدث فيها عملية جديدة في النظام. يتم استخدام الطوابع الزمنية المنطقية لتوفير ترتيب نسبي للأحداث وعادة ما يتم تنفيذها عبر طوابع Lamport الزمنية أو طوابع Vector الزمنية. من خلال الاستفادة من هذه ، يمكن للتطبيقات إدارة عمليات البيانات مع تجنب المشكلات المتعلقة بساعة النظام.

بالإضافة إلى حالات الاستخدام المذكورة أعلاه ، يمكن استخدام الطوابع الزمنية بشكل فعال لآليات التحكم في التزامن مثل التحكم في التزامن المستند إلى الطابع الزمني والتحكم في التزامن متعدد الوسائط (MVCC). تضمن هذه الآليات تنفيذ عمليات المعاملات بدقة واتساق مع الحفاظ على العزلة وبالترتيب الصحيح.

علاوة على ذلك ، تسهل الطوابع الزمنية ممارسات التدقيق وتحليل البيانات ، وتوفر معلومات حول الوقت المحدد لإنشاء البيانات وتعديلها. يمكن للتطبيقات مثل ذكاء الأعمال والتحليلات والامتثال التنظيمي الاستفادة من الطوابع الزمنية لاتخاذ قرارات تعتمد على البيانات وتقييم البيانات التاريخية بدقة.

AppMaster ، وهو نظام أساسي رائد لا يحتوي على تعليمات برمجية لتطوير تطبيقات الويب والجوال والخلفية ، يحتضن الطوابع الزمنية كجزء لا يتجزأ من التطبيقات التي تم إنشاؤها. باستخدام AppMaster ، يمكن للمستخدمين إنشاء تطبيقات موثوقة وقابلة للتطوير بكفاءة تستخدم الطوابع الزمنية لإدارة البيانات والعمليات والمزامنة بسلاسة. تدعم POSTGRESQL ، قاعدة البيانات الأساسية المتوافقة مع AppMaster ، أنواع بيانات TIMESTAMP المختلفة ، مثل TIMESTAMP و TIMESTAMP WITH TIME ZONE و TIMESTAMP بدون منطقة زمنية. تسمح هذه المرونة للمطورين بإدارة البيانات الحساسة للوقت بناءً على متطلباتهم المحددة بكفاءة.

من خلال إنشاء برامج نصية لترحيل مخطط قاعدة البيانات باستخدام AppMaster ، يمكن للمطورين استخدام الطوابع الزمنية لتتبع تغييرات المخطط ، وتحليل اتجاهات البيانات ، والحفاظ على اتساق البيانات. علاوة على ذلك ، يمكنهم استخدام وثائق Swagger المُنشأة تلقائيًا (Open API) الخاصة بـ AppMaster ، مما يتيح تكاملًا سلسًا مع واجهة برمجة التطبيقات مع تطبيقات متعددة.

الطوابع الزمنية هي مكونات قاعدة البيانات الأساسية التي تقدم العديد من الفوائد لتكامل البيانات والاتساق والمزامنة. إنها ضرورية في إدارة التطبيقات المعقدة وضمان دقة تشغيلها وأدائها. تعمل منصة AppMaster المبتكرة الخالية no-code على تبسيط عملية دمج الطوابع الزمنية في تطبيقاتك ، وتمكين المطورين من إنشاء تطبيقات قوية وقابلة للتطوير وحساسة للوقت بسهولة.

المنشورات ذات الصلة

المفتاح لفتح إستراتيجيات تحقيق الدخل من تطبيقات الهاتف المحمول
المفتاح لفتح إستراتيجيات تحقيق الدخل من تطبيقات الهاتف المحمول
اكتشف كيفية إطلاق العنان لإمكانيات الإيرادات الكاملة لتطبيقك للجوال من خلال إستراتيجيات تحقيق الدخل التي أثبتت جدواها، بما في ذلك الإعلانات وعمليات الشراء داخل التطبيق والاشتراكات.
الاعتبارات الأساسية عند اختيار منشئ تطبيقات الذكاء الاصطناعي
الاعتبارات الأساسية عند اختيار منشئ تطبيقات الذكاء الاصطناعي
عند اختيار منشئ تطبيقات الذكاء الاصطناعي، من الضروري مراعاة عوامل مثل إمكانيات التكامل وسهولة الاستخدام وقابلية التوسع. ترشدك هذه المقالة إلى الاعتبارات الأساسية لاتخاذ قرار مستنير.
نصائح لإشعارات الدفع الفعالة في PWAs
نصائح لإشعارات الدفع الفعالة في PWAs
اكتشف فن صياغة إشعارات الدفع الفعالة لتطبيقات الويب التقدمية (PWAs) التي تعزز مشاركة المستخدم وتضمن ظهور رسائلك في مساحة رقمية مزدحمة.
ابدأ مجانًا
من وحي تجربة هذا بنفسك؟

أفضل طريقة لفهم قوة AppMaster هي رؤيتها بنفسك. اصنع تطبيقك الخاص في دقائق مع اشتراك مجاني

اجعل أفكارك تنبض بالحياة